The Mandatory Map: The Parish-by-Parish Grid

This is the single most critical geographic reality facing numerical analysts inside Louisiana borders. Unlike monolithic states, Louisiana’s sports betting legalization was decided at the individual local government level.

  • Out of Louisiana’s 64 Parishes, voters in 55 Parishes approved sports betting.
  • In 9 Parishes, sports betting remains 100% STRICTLY ILLEGAL.

The Banned Parishes Checklist:

You are federally prohibited from placing any wager while physically standing inside the following parishes: Caldwell, Catahoula, Franklin, Jackson, La Salle, Sabine, Union, West Carroll, and Winn.

  • The Strategic Implication: If you drive across parish lines, the GeoComply plugin on your DraftKings or Caesars app will instantly lock your account. Advanced traders operating in northern/central Louisiana must Use stable home Wi-Fi to prevent cellular GPS tower drift from triggering false positives inside a banned parish.

The SEC Catalyst: Unrestricted Collegiate Prop Freedom

While the vast majority of SEC markets (like Florida or Tennessee) strictly ban college props, Louisiana remains a glorious, highly lucrative exception.

The Louisiana Access Checklist:

  1. YES to Louisiana Colleges: You can legally wager on the LSU Tigers, Tulane Green Wave, Ragin’ Cajuns, and all other state programs.
  2. YES to Collegiate Props (Elite Status): Crucially, Louisiana is one of the final remaining Deep South markets allowing full Individual Player Proposition bets on college athletes. You can legally bet on an LSU quarterback’s passing yards or an SEC receiver’s anytime touchdown.

State Tax Efficiency: The Low 4.25% Net Edge

Louisiana offers an exceptionally clean, highly competitive fiscal climate that directly supports bankroll velocity.

The Rate: 1.85% to 4.25% Progressive Scale.

Louisiana enforces one of the lowest and most favorable state income tax schedules in the entire nation.

Favorable Net Loss Deductibility (Highly Lucrative):

Unlike neighboring Mississippi (which taxes gross wins heavily), Louisiana tax authorities explicitly permit individual taxpayers to deduct gambling losses up to the extent of their winnings on their IT-540 state returns.
